A PERIOD PROPERTY WITH AMPLE PARKING TO THE REAR
A beautifully presented period home, ideally situated within easy walking distance of the town centre, offering a well-balanced combination of character, modern convenience and attractive outdoor space. The property also benefits from driveway parking to the rear.
The accommodation is arranged over two floors and retains a number of appealing original period features.
On entering the property, the welcoming entrance hall provides access to both the dining room and living room. The living room enjoys a pleasant aspect over the south-facing rear garden, creating a light and inviting space. The dining room provides a versatile area for both everyday dining and entertaining.
To the rear of the property is the galley-style kitchen, fitted with a range of modern wall and base units, together with an integrated oven and hob. There are designated spaces for a washing machine and fridge/freezer. The kitchen leads through to a useful rear porch, which provides direct access to the garden, as well as the separate utility room.
To the first floor are two well-proportioned double bedrooms, providing comfortable and versatile accommodation. The family bathroom is particularly characterful and features a roll-top bath, separate shower cubicle and ornate wash hand basin, creating an attractive blend of period style and modern practicality.
Externally, the property enjoys a sunny, south-facing rear garden, offering an attractive private outdoor space and excellent potential for seating and entertaining. The garden also provides access to the rear driveway, which offers off-road parking for two vehicles.
Further benefits include gas-fired central heating, driveway parking and a selection of retained period features, all complemented by the property's convenient position within walking distance of the town centre.
Tenure: We understand that the property for sale is Freehold
Local Authority: Wychavon District Council
Council Tax Band: We understand that the Council Tax Band for the property is Band B
